Understanding Cockatiels
Before diving into the purchasing process, it's important to understand what makes cockatiels special. Belonging to Australia, these small parrots (Nymphicus hollandicus) are understood for their affectionate nature, ability to mimic sounds, and lively behavior.

Cockatiels usually weigh in between 80 and 120 grams and measure about 12 to 14 inches in length, including their long tails. Can I keep a cockatiel alone?
Yes, cockatiels can adjust to living alone, however they are social animals. If possible, consider getting a 2nd cockatiel for companionship.
2. Are cockatiels great for newbies?
Absolutely! Their friendly nature and relatively simple care make them an exceptional choice for newbie bird owners.
3. Do cockatiels need a lot of attention?
Cockatiels prosper on social interaction and should be handled routinely to establish a strong bond with their owners.

5. What is the best diet for a cockatiel?
A balanced diet must consist of premium pellets, fresh fruits, and veggies, in addition to periodic seeds as deals with.
